#df50cf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#df50cf is composed of 87.5% red, 31.4%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.1% magenta, 7.2%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 306.7 degrees, a saturation of 69.1% and a lightness of 59.4%. #df50cf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a0ff with #bf009f.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#df50cf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070107 is the darkest color, while #fdf6f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#df50cf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f909e is the less saturated color, while #ff30e8 is the most saturated one.
